Are
you unemployed and looking for a good opportunity? If yes, then you
must be dropping your CVs and resumes to different places. A Resume is a profound document in which you
present your academics information, your acquired skill, and your
employment summary and bio data in an impressive form. You can say
that this document creates your first impression on the employer. So,
it needs to be prepared in a proper format. It should be providing
the answers of the questions raised by the employer in the form of
job application. A well documented Curriculum Vitae represents your
attitude towards your work and professionalism.
If
you have applied at many places and you know that you have the
desired qualification for the applied job but you are still not
getting hired or being called for the interview then it is a time to
check your CV. Every day the prospective company gets number of CVs,
the HR department sorts out the CVs to call the candidates for the
interview. Check that is your CV showing all your skills in the
impressive manner or not, have you mentioned your experience visibly,
is the font size appropriate for reading? All these things are very
important to get the call for the interview. It happens that
sometimes the information is not displayed in a classified manner and
your CV becomes fail to grab the attention.
